Chris Brown, who faced multiple accusations of misconduct and legal issues, has announced his new album BROWN.

The 37-year-old singer turned to his social media and unveiled the star-studded collaborators from the music industry.

However, Chris was mocked by the online community as he shared an album artwork which carried an old school essence with his picture in the centre.

A netizen slammed the update for looking “like those thumbnails for the AI generated ‘soul covers’ of these artists you find on YouTube.”

Another admitted that they “found this disrespectful” as it was artificially generated, while a third joked that the Under The Influence songmaker is someone “that uses AI wrong all the time.”

The musician introduced all the collaborations on his project, including NBA YoungBoy, Leon Thomas, Tank, Vybz Kartel, GloRilla, Bryson Tiller, Fridayy, Sexyy Red and Lucky Daye.

Despite all the backlash, fans have high hope for the song Call Your Name which features Sexyy Red.

Why was Chris Brown boycotted?

This came after Chris was called out and boycotted by many for arrest and charged in 2025 due to a Nightclub incident for bodily harm.

He has had a history of legal troubles which included physically assaulting her then-girlfriend Rihanna in 2009. 

The incident unfolded after a pre-Grammy party which resulted in facial injuries.
